miniangel

Just a general word of caution for anyone thinking of trying out some toys. They have to be specifically designed for anal use, IOW easily retrievable, i.e. with flanges or cords or whatever. Don't use vaginal toys or just any old object unless you fancy a potentially embarrassing trip to your local hospital.
